匿名内部类
举例 collections.sort中的 比较接口Comparator
Collections.sort(list, new Comparator<String>() {
@Override
public int compare(String o1, String o2) {
return 0;
}
});
通常是通过定义一个接口 然后直接new这个接口实现的
public interface Comparator<T> {
int compare(T o1, T o2);
boolean equals(Object obj);
}